| Re: Spyware FAQ and download list. Yeah ive had the pain of New.Net quite recently.
I had a thread about it a week or two back, although back then i didnt realise that's what was causing the odd behaviour. I didnt actually suffer re-directs, but it caused timeouts when opening browser windows. I think I ended up fixing it fairly easily, it seems the install had been blocked midway by protowall and so i could quite easily remove it by deleting its folder and reg entries then using spybot to clean up. It also didnt show up on a hijack this log afterwards.

| Re: Spyware FAQ and download list. Aye, it's actually hijacking in the LSP portion of the TCP/IP stack so it injects itself into HTTP requests rather than per browser. Fucker. |
